1
0
Files
CPP_Module_08/ex01/Span.hpp
2025-04-16 10:37:35 +02:00

35 lines
1.1 KiB
C++

/* ************************************************************************** */
/* */
/* ::: :::::::: */
/* Span.hpp :+: :+: :+: */
/* +:+ +:+ +:+ */
/* By: adjoly <adjoly@student.42angouleme.fr> +#+ +:+ +#+ */
/* +#+#+#+#+#+ +#+ */
/* Created: 2025/04/14 19:54:33 by adjoly #+# #+# */
/* Updated: 2025/04/16 10:12:43 by adjoly ### ########.fr */
/* */
/* ************************************************************************** */
#pragma once
#include <vector>
#include <stdint.h>
class Span {
public:
Span(unsigned int);
~Span(void);
void addNumber(int);
int shortestSpan(void);
int longestSpan(void);
private:
Span(void);
std::vector<int> _vec;
uint32_t _size;
uint32_t _i;
};